Why This Monster Cookie Cheesecake Delight Recipe Works

This recipe is special because it combines two beloved desserts into one irresistible treat. The creamy cheesecake layer is enriched with chunks of monster cookies, adding texture and flavor. Each bite is a perfect balance of sweet and savory, with the gooey chocolate and peanut butter chips creating a delightful experience.

The technique of blending the cookie ingredients with the cheesecake batter ensures that every slice contains bits of cookie goodness. Baking at a controlled temperature allows the cheesecake to set without cracking, yielding a beautifully smooth texture that melts in your mouth.

πŸ’‘ Professional Tip

Make sure your cream cheese is at room temperature for smooth mixing. Overmixing can introduce too much air, leading to cracks in your cheesecake. If you prefer a richer flavor, add a tablespoon of lemon juice to the batter for a subtle citrus twist.

Recipe Troubleshooting Guide

βœ…

Too Dry

Problem: If your cheesecake turns out too dry, it may have been overbaked.

Solution: To avoid this, monitor the cooking time closely and remove the cheesecake from the oven when it is still slightly jiggly in the center. Additionally, adding more sour cream can enhance moisture.

βœ…

Not Crispy Enough

Problem: If the crust isn't crispy, it may not have been baked long enough.

Solution: Ensure you bake the crust for about 10 minutes before adding the cheesecake filling to achieve a crispy texture.

βœ…

Overcooked

Problem: Overcooking can lead to a dry and cracked cheesecake.

Prevention: To prevent overcooking, use a water bath when baking and check for doneness a few minutes before the recommended time.

βœ…

Undercooked Center

Problem: An undercooked center can be a result of baking at too low a temperature.

Recovery: To fix this, ensure your oven is properly calibrated, and bake the cheesecake until the edges are set and the center is slightly jiggly.

βœ…

Burnt Exterior

Problem: A burnt exterior can occur if the oven temperature is too high.

Prevention: To prevent this, consider lowering your oven temperature or using a baking shield to protect the edges of the cheesecake.

βœ…

Flavor Balance

Too Sweet: If the cheesecake is too sweet, you can balance it by adding a pinch of salt to enhance the flavors.

Too Salty: If it’s too salty, adding a bit of sugar can help neutralize the saltiness.

Bland: For bland flavors, add more vanilla or a splash of lemon juice to brighten the taste.

Essential Ingredient Notes

  • Cream Cheese: Opt for full-fat cream cheese for a rich and creamy texture. Soften it to room temperature before mixing to avoid lumps and ensure a smooth batter.
  • Monster Cookies: Use soft, chewy monster cookies for the best results. If they're homemade, let them cool completely before crushing to avoid excess moisture.
  • Chocolate Chips: Choose quality chocolate chips that melt well for a smooth cheesecake. Dark chocolate can add a rich depth of flavor if you prefer a more intense taste.

Key Technique for Perfect Monster Cookie Cheesecake Delight

The key technique for this recipe is to mix the ingredients gently to avoid incorporating too much air, which can cause cracks. Additionally, baking in a water bath can help maintain moisture and achieve a silky texture.
